    Not this Summer, but next Summer is the best possible time to bring Sergio over due to his buyout/contract situation. Sergio has it made right now over in Spain and he shouldn't respectfully be asked to come over to the NBA on any team that didnt really have a shot at giving him the starting role.

    Everyone seems to understand this within the Rockets organization. However, if they strike a major deal involving Lowry this Summer, dont think for a moment that they wont make a call overseas to inquire about coming over this Summer. I think a deal could be had, but it all has to do with what kind of need they have for him, and what is the playing time situation.

    You look at the Scola/ SA situation as a perfect example of what could happen if the buyout is too large and there isnt the opportunity for playing time. If he doesn't come over by next Summer, I think he's for sure going to be just part of a trade filler going forward if they can move him IMO. Its all about next Summer, and the opportunity that might or might not present itself.
